ターゲット情報

  • 機能

    Cytochromes P450 are a group of heme-thiolate monooxygenases. In liver microsomes, this enzyme is involved in an NADPH-dependent electron transport pathway. It oxidizes a variety of structurally unrelated compounds, including steroids, fatty acids, and xenobiotics. Most active in catalyzing 2-hydroxylation. Caffeine is metabolized primarily by cytochrome CYP1A2 in the liver through an initial N3-demethylation. Also acts in the metabolism of aflatoxin B1 and acetaminophen. Participates in the bioactivation of carcinogenic aromatic and heterocyclic amines. Catalizes the N-hydroxylation of heterocyclic amines and the O-deethylation of phenacetin.
  • 組織特異性

    Liver.
  • 配列類似性

    Belongs to the cytochrome P450 family.
  • 細胞内局在

    Endoplasmic reticulum membrane. Microsome membrane.

    • Flow Cytometry (Intracellular) -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)
      Flow Cytometry (Intracellular) -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)

      Intracellular Flow Cytometry analysis of MCF7 (Human breast adenocarcinoma epithelial cell) cells labeling Cytochrome P450 1A2 with purified ab151728 at 1/200 dilution (10 µg/ml) (Red). Cells were fixed with 4% Paraformaldehyde and permeabilised with 90% Methanol. A Goat anti rabbit IgG (Alexa Fluor® 488, ab150077) secondary antibody was used at 1/2000. Isotype control - Rabbit monoclonal IgG (Black). Unlabeled control - Cell without incubation with primary antibody and secondary antibody (Blue).

       

    • Immunocytochemistry/ Immunofluorescence -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)
      Immunocytochemistry/ Immunofluorescence -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)

      Immunofluorescent analysis of HeLa cells labeling Cytochrome P450 1A2 with unpurified ab151728 at 1/250 dilution.

    • Flow Cytometry (Intracellular) -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)
      Flow Cytometry (Intracellular) - Anti-Cytochrome P450 1A2 antibody [EPR6138(2)] (ab151728)

      Overlay histogram showing MCF7 cells stained with unpurified ab151728 (red line). The cells were fixed with 4% paraformaldehyde (10 min) and then permeabilized with 0.1% PBS-Tween for 20 min. The cells were then incubated in 1x PBS / 10% normal goat serum / 0.3M glycine to block non-specific protein-protein interactions followed by the antibody (ab151728, 1/10000 dilution) for 30 min at 22°C. The secondary antibody used was Alexa Fluor® 488 goat anti-rabbit IgG (H&L) (ab150077) at 1/2000 dilution for 30 min at 22°C. Isotype control antibody (black line) was rabbit IgG (monoclonal) (0.1µg/1x106 cells) used under the same conditions. Unlabelled sample (blue line) was also used as a control. Acquisition of >5,000 events were collected using a 20mW Argon ion laser (488nm) and 525/30 bandpass filter. This antibody gave a positive signal in MCF7 cells fixed with 80% methanol (5 min)/permeabilized with 0.1% PBS-Tween for 20 min used under the same conditions.

    Question

    Inquiry: Did this Ab cross react with others CYP1A notably CYP1A1 ?

    Read More

    Abcam community

    Verified customer

    Asked on May 23 2013

    Answer

    Unfortunately, I am sorry to confirm we did not specifically test ab151728 CYP1A antibody for this cross reactivity. However, we did a BLAST with the immunogen sequence and this indicates that theoretically this antibody will not cross react with other CYP1A proteins. We ran an alignment, specifically with the sequence for CYP1A1, and the homology is very low (not significant).
